Who is virtual assistant?

Opening Statement

A virtual assistant is a person who provides administrative, secretarial, or creative assistance to clients remotely, typically via the internet.

They can perform a wide range of tasks, including customer service, data entry, bookkeeping, social media management, and more.

Virtual assistants are often used by busy entrepreneurs and small business owners who need help with day-to-day tasks but don’t have the time or resources to hire a full-time employee.

What exactly does a virtual assistant do?

A virtual assistant can be a great asset to your business, offering administrative support on a part-time basis. They can handle tasks that an executive assistant would typically take care of, such as scheduling appointments, making phone calls, arranging travel, or organizing emails. Having a virtual assistant can free up your time so that you can focus on other aspects of your business.

Do virtual assistants get paid?

As a virtual assistant myself, I can attest to the wide range of pay in the industry. Depending on your skill level, years of experience, industry, and clientele, you can make anywhere from $22,000 to $60,000 per year. Hourly rates for virtual assistants can range from $10.75 to $27.46, with a median hourly rate of about $17.

There are many factors that contribute to the wide range in pay, but I think it ultimately comes down to supply and demand. There are many virtual assistants out there competing for work, so rates tend to be lower. On the other hand, if you have niche skills or experience, you can command a higher rate.

Virtual assistants come in all shapes and sizes, each with their own unique set of skills and experience. Here are 10 of the most popular types of virtual assistants:

1) Administrative virtual assistant: A virtual assistant who specializes in administrative tasks such as scheduling, email management, and travel planning.

2) Bookkeeping virtual assistant: A virtual assistant who specializes in bookkeeping and accounting tasks.

3) Social Media Virtual Assistant: A virtual assistant who specializes in social media tasks such as content creation, community management, and social media marketing.

4) Real Estate Virtual Assistant: A virtual assistant who specializes in tasks related to the real estate industry, such as lead generation, property management, and market research.

5) Shopping and e-commerce virtual assistants: A virtual assistant who specializes in tasks related to shopping and e-commerce, such as product research, order processing, and customer service.

6) Blog virtual assistants: A virtual assistant who specializes in tasks related to blogging, such as content creation, keyword research, and blog promotion.

7) Customer Service virtual assistants: A virtual assistant who specializes in customer service, such as order processing, customer support, and live chat.

Can you work as a virtual assistant with no experience

If you have the right skills and traits, you can absolutely become a virtual assistant without any prior experience. The key is to plan ahead and make sure that you have what it takes to be successful in this role. There are a few things you should keep in mind as you pursue a career as a VA:

First, you must be extremely organized and detail-oriented. This is one of the most important qualities of a successful VA. You will need to be able to keep track of multiple tasks and deadlines, as well as manage a variety of clients and projects.

Second, you must be a good communicator. This involves both written and verbal communication skills. You will need to be able to communicate effectively with your clients in order to provide them with the best possible service.

Third, you must be tech-savvy. This is an increasingly important skill in today’s business world. You will need to be comfortable using a variety of computer programs and applications, as well as keeping up with the latest technology trends.

If you have these skills and traits, you can be a successful virtual assistant. Just make sure to plan ahead and be prepared for the challenges that come with this career.

As a virtual assistant with no experience, you are usually eligible for entry-level positions. General duties may include helping clients draft emails and letters, schedule appointments, and organize electronic files.

Where can I learn virtual assistant?

There are a number of free virtual assistant courses available online which can be useful for those looking to get started in this field. Hubspot Academy, Copyblogger Design School and Codeacademy offer great resources for learning the basics of virtual assistant work. For more advanced training, Hootsuite Platform Certification Course and CreativeLive Social Media Marketing Foundations offer excellent courses that cover a variety of topics related to virtual assistance.

How much do virtual assistants work

As a general rule, the more skills and experience a virtual assistant has, the higher their hourly rate will be. On Upwork, the average hourly rate for a freelance virtual assistant ranges from $18-35/hour, depending on the specific skills and experience they have to offer. Some of the factors that can affect a virtual assistant’s hourly rate include the type of work they’re able to do, their level of experience, and the specifics of the project they’re working on.

There are a few challenges that come with using virtual assistants. Firstly, connectivity issues can be a problem in parts of the globe with slower internet speeds. Secondly, communication can be difficult because you are not able to talk to the person face to face. Thirdly, language barriers can be an issue if the virtual assistant does not speak your language fluently. Fourthly, routines can be circuitous if you are not familiar with the technology. Fifthly, distractions can be a problem if you are not used to working from home. Sixthly, stress can be a difference if you are not used to working in a virtual environment.
